How Must-Drop Jackpots Actually Work

A must-drop jackpot operates on a timer or a monetary threshold. The provider sets a maximum value, and when the jackpot reaches that ceiling, it must pay out on the next qualifying spin, regardless of the base game result. Some games tie the trigger to a random moment within a defined window; others simply guarantee the prize once a specific contribution level is hit.

Volatility in these games tends to sit in the medium-to-high range. The base game usually offers modest wins, while the jackpot itself delivers the headline payout. RTP figures typically fall between 94% and 96.5%, which is slightly below the industry average for non-jackpot slots. That shortfall is the cost of funding the guaranteed prize pool, and it is worth understanding before you spin.

Reading RTP and Volatility Like a Professional

Return to Player is a theoretical figure calculated over millions of spins. It tells you the long-term expected return, not what will happen in your session. A 96% RTP slot will not return £96 for every £100 you stake tonight; it means that over an enormous sample, the game returns that proportion. Short-term variance can and will produce swings in either direction.

Volatility describes the distribution of those swings. Low-volatility games pay small amounts frequently, which suits cautious bankrolls. High-volatility games pay less often but offer larger wins when they land. For must-drop jackpots, you are effectively buying a ticket to a guaranteed event, so the base game volatility determines how comfortable the wait feels.

Under the UKGC regime, all licensed games must use certified random number generators. Independent testing houses such as eCOGRA and iTech Labs audit these systems regularly, and the certification is not a marketing badge but a regulatory requirement. If a game is available at a UKGC-licensed operator, the RNG has passed independent scrutiny.

The Feature Mechanics That Define the Category

Must-drop jackpots rarely travel alone. Providers bundle them with familiar mechanics to keep the base game engaging. Megaways engines, for instance, offer up to 117,649 ways to win on every spin, which increases the frequency of smaller hits while the jackpot clock runs. The cascading reels in these games also create a sense of momentum that suits the waiting game.

Hold-and-nudge features are equally common. These give you control over individual reels, letting you lock a symbol in place while the others respin. In jackpot contexts, these mechanics often appear in the bonus round, where collecting specific symbols can accelerate your progress towards the must-drop trigger.

Wild multipliers and free-spin rounds serve a dual purpose. They provide genuine win potential in the base game, and they also contribute to the jackpot meter. A well-designed title makes you forget you are waiting for a guaranteed payout, because the base game offers enough entertainment value on its own. Stake Limits and Responsible Session Structure

Since 2025, UKGC rules have capped online slot stakes at £5 per spin, with a tighter £2 limit for players aged 18 to 24. These are hard regulatory limits, not operator choices. Must-drop jackpot slots fall squarely within these rules, so the most expensive single spin you can place is £5, and younger players face the reduced ceiling.

Credit card gambling has been banned in Great Britain since April 2020, so funding your play requires a debit card, e-wallet, or bank transfer. These payment methods also make it easier to track your spending, which is a genuine advantage for session discipline.

Structuring your session sensibly starts with a clear budget. Decide in advance how much you are willing to lose, and treat that figure as the cost of entertainment. A reasonable approach is to divide your bankroll into ten or twenty units, and to stop when the units are gone. The must-drop guarantee is a comfort, but it does not change the mathematics of the base game.

Terms Glossary for Must-Drop Jackpots

Term Plain-English Meaning Practical Note
Must-drop trigger The point at which the jackpot is guaranteed to pay Check the visible counter before you spin
Contribution rate The percentage of each stake added to the jackpot pool Higher rates mean faster triggers
Reset value The jackpot amount after a win, before it starts growing again Lower resets mean quicker subsequent cycles
Qualifying spin A spin that can trigger the jackpot once the threshold is met Usually any spin at the minimum stake
Wagering requirement The turnover needed before bonus funds become withdrawable Typically 20x to 65x, set by the operator

Wagering requirements vary by operator and are commercial terms rather than legal rules. A £50 bonus at 35x, for example, requires £1,750 in turnover before withdrawal. Read the terms before you accept any promotion.

Quickfire Answers on Must-Drop Jackpots

Do must-drop jackpots pay more often than progressive ones?

Yes. Progressives can go months without paying, while must-drop games have a guaranteed ceiling. The trade-off is a smaller maximum prize, typically in the thousands rather than millions.

Should I choose a game based on RTP alone?

No. RTP tells you the long-term return, but volatility determines your session experience. A high-RTP game with extreme volatility can still wipe out a small bankroll quickly.

How does the £5 stake limit affect jackpot play?

The cap limits your per-spin exposure but does not change the jackpot odds. The trigger is random within its window, so smaller stakes still qualify for the full prize.

What is the difference between a timer and a contribution trigger?

A timer guarantees a payout within a set period, regardless of stakes. A contribution trigger requires the pool to reach a specific value, which depends on how much players are wagering.

When should I use demo play before betting real money?

Always, if it is available. Demo play lets you observe the jackpot pacing and base game volatility without cost, which is especially valuable for high-volatility titles.
